Common Cryptocurrency Scams in India
Fake Investment Platforms
Scammers create fake crypto trading websites that display false profits and encourage victims to invest larger amounts.
Cryptocurrency Giveaway Scams
Fraudsters promise free Bitcoin or other cryptocurrencies in exchange for an initial payment.
Phishing Attacks
Victims receive fake emails, messages, or websites that steal wallet credentials and login information.
WhatsApp & Telegram Investment Groups
Fraudsters use social media groups to promote fake investment opportunities and manipulated trading results.
Fake Recovery Services
Many victims are targeted a second time by individuals claiming they can recover lost cryptocurrency for an upfront fee.
What To Do Immediately After a Cryptocurrency Scam
1. Stop All Further Payments
Do not send additional funds, verification charges, taxes, or recovery fees to the scammers.
2. Preserve All Evidence
Collect and save:
- Wallet addresses
- Transaction IDs (TXIDs)
- Exchange account details
- Screenshots of chats
- Emails and messages
- Payment receipts
- Bank transaction records
This information may be useful during investigations.
3. Call Cyber Crime Helpline 1930
Report the fraud immediately through the national cybercrime helpline.
The faster a complaint is filed, the greater the possibility of tracing connected financial transactions.

How Cryptocurrency Scam Recovery Works
Many cryptocurrency transactions are recorded on public blockchains. Investigators can sometimes analyze transaction trails and identify links between wallets, exchanges, and financial accounts.
Recovery efforts may involve:
Blockchain Analysis
Tracking cryptocurrency movement between wallets and exchanges.
Cyber Crime Investigation
Reviewing digital evidence, transaction records, and communication history.
Exchange Cooperation
Some exchanges may cooperate with law enforcement agencies during investigations.
Legal Action
Victims may pursue legal remedies depending on the circumstances of the fraud.
Challenges in Recovering Cryptocurrency
Cryptocurrency recovery can be difficult because:
- Scammers often move funds rapidly between wallets.
- Transactions may cross international borders.
- Anonymous wallets can complicate investigations.
- Victims sometimes delay reporting incidents.
This is why immediate reporting is critical.

Warning Signs of a Crypto Scam
Watch out for:
🚨 Guaranteed returns
🚨 Pressure to invest quickly
🚨 Fake celebrity endorsements
🚨 Requests for wallet seed phrases
🚨 Unverified investment groups
🚨 Recovery services demanding upfront fees
If something sounds too good to be true, it probably is.
Tips To Stay Safe From Cryptocurrency Fraud
- Use trusted exchanges only.
- Enable two-factor authentication (2FA).
- Never share wallet recovery phrases.
- Verify website URLs carefully.
- Avoid investment schemes promising guaranteed profits.
- Research projects before investing.
- Be cautious of unsolicited messages and investment advice.
Cyber awareness remains one of the strongest defenses against digital fraud.

Can cryptocurrency be recovered after a scam in India?
Recovery may be possible depending on the circumstances of the case, available evidence, and how quickly the fraud is reported.
What should I do immediately after a cryptocurrency scam?
Stop further payments, preserve evidence, call 1930, file a complaint at cybercrime.gov.in, and report the incident to any involved exchange.
Is cryptocurrency fraud a cybercrime in India?
Yes. Cryptocurrency-related fraud may fall under cybercrime and financial fraud investigations depending on the nature of the incident.
What evidence should I keep?
Save transaction IDs, wallet addresses, screenshots, emails, chats, and any payment records related to the fraud.
Can blockchain transactions be traced?
Many cryptocurrency transactions are publicly recorded on blockchain networks and can sometimes be analyzed by investigators.
